SOCRadar today launched Hacker Score, a new tool designed to help Managed Security Service Providers (MSSPs) and Managed Service Providers (MSPs) garner immediate trust with prospects by showing them where they are vulnerable using automated external exposure checks in order to generate leads. Available free of charge for a limited time, Hacker Score delivers an instant score of a prospect’s digital footprint, identifying vulnerabilities, leaked credentials, and surface/dark web exposures without a complex set up.
MSSPs and MSPs continue to struggle with the manual, time-consuming process of conducting initial security assessments for prospects. Standard “scans” often lack the depth of Extended Threat Intelligence (XTI), making it difficult for them to differentiate their services from their competitors and prove the necessity of their security stack in a crowded market.
Hacker Score helps organizations see themselves through the eyes of an attacker. By continuously monitoring more than 150 indicators and attack vectors that hackers typically evaluate before launching an attack, Hacker Score reveals what adversaries already know about an organization. Combining attack surface intelligence with SOCRadar’s deep and dark web datasets, including stealer logs, compromised credentials, ransomware intelligence, and phishing infrastructure, Hacker Score delivers a real-world assessment of organizational exposure and highlights the weaknesses most likely to be targeted.
Hacker Score’s features include:
- External Attack Surface Mapping: Provides visibility into all internet-facing assets.
- Credential Leak Detection: Identifies employee data exposed in recent breaches or stealer logs.
- Vulnerability Assessment: Instantly identifies critical, exploitable vulnerabilities across a prospect’s infrastructure.
- Supply Chain Risk: Evaluates the risk levels of a prospect’s third-party ecosystem.
